Re-Opening for Negotiations. This Agreement shall be reopened at the request of either party to consider the impact of legislation enacted following the execution of this Agreement which affects the terms and conditions herein.

  • Opening Negotiations 4.2.1 Between April 1 and April 30 of each ensuing year, either the Association or the Board shall submit a written request for negotiations to commence to the other party, if it desires there to be negotiations for that year. If no such request is made during the time period above, negotiations will not take place for the ensuing year. 4.2.2 The first negotiations session shall occur on a mutually agreeable date not more than thirty (30) days from the date of the written request to open negotiations. 4.2.3 The parties will exchange proposals at the initial negotiating session. Subsequent proposals may only be submitted upon mutual agreement of the parties.

  • Term and Reopening Negotiations This Agreement shall remain in full force and effect for a period commencing on July 1, 2021 through June 30, 2023 and thereafter until modifications are made pursuant to the P.E.L.R.A. If either party desires to modify or amend this Agreement commencing on July 1, it shall give written notice of such intent no later than May 1. Unless otherwise mutually agreed, the parties shall not commence negotiations more than 90 days prior to the expiration of the Agreement.

  • Exclusive Negotiations The State will not bargain collectively or meet with any employee organization other than MSEA-SEIU with reference to terms and conditions of employment of employees covered by this Agreement. If any such organizations request meetings they will be advised by the State to transmit their requests concerning terms and conditions of employment to MSEA-SEIU.
